 Old Fashion Butter Molds


Not everyone's mamma churned and fashioned her own butter. So if you've never seen it done or been told, you may not know how to use these butter molds. So listen up . . .here's what our Granny says:

"Take your softened butter. (Fresh churned butter, umm umm good, or softened store bought.) Make sure there is no water in the butter. If you've churned your own butter, you know what I mean.

Pull the knob up on the butter mold, turn it upside down like you're holding a cup. Then press in your softened butter. Press it in hard, a little bit at a time to get all of the air out. Fill it and pack it in good. Then lay a piece of wax paper on the opened end. Set it in the ice box [that's a refrigerator for us modern folks] and let it harden for a least a day. Take off the wax paper and gently slide the butter out of the mold by pressing down on the handle slowly. Set your butter on a fancy dish, and it's ready to take to the country fair!
